The supreme commander of the Armed Forces of the Chechen Republic Ichkeria, Abdul-Hakim Shishani, who supports Ukraine in the military conflict, talked in an interview with 'RBK-Ukraine' about the tactics of the Russians at the front.
Their tactics have remained unchanged since the Second World War - 'meat assaults', when a large number of unprepared soldiers are thrown in. Russia can apply this tactic with a large population, but I believe that Ukraine will reclaim its territories if it receives support from the international community.
According to Abdul-Hakim Shishani, Ukraine will be able to reclaim all its territories if it has enough weapons.
It does not matter whether it is Crimea or Donbas. If we receive everything we need: planes, long-range systems, then we will reclaim all territories - Crimea, Donbas, Kherson. This will end the war for Ukraine, but for us, the Chechens, while we do not reclaim our territories, the military conflict will continue.
Earlier, Abdul-Hakim Shishani condemned the annexation of Crimea.
